For many years the identity of the author was a mystery. First attributed to Pietro Aretino , an article in 1888 by Achille Neri finally identified the author as Antonio Rocco, a Libertine priest and philosopher and member of the Accademia Degli Incogniti , founded by Giovan Battista Loredan . The obscenity of the text is unremandingly explicit, but it has been argued, "it must be understood in the context of similar texts of the trend of Libertinism , using the term in its original sense of a sceptical philosophical tendency."
